One passenger dead after plane engine explodes above US, partially sucking woman out of window

One person died when an engine blew out on a Dallas-bound Southwest Airlines jet mid-flight on Tuesday, forcing the plane to make an emergency landing at Philadelphia International Airport, the airline and US officials said.

Todd Baur, who identified himself as the father of a passenger from the plane, said a female passenger was injured when she was partially sucked into a window near the afflicted engine before being pulled back into the aircraft by other passengers.
